Uploaded by on Apr 9, 2007

1. cut the Kimchi
2. put into a pan with the oil
3. fry them for 3 minutes
4. put the tuna and rice there
stir them well for 5 minutes
5. serve with a slice cheese


It's delicious!!! ^_____^;
